The Science of Corn Starch

Corn starch is a carbohydrate found in corn kernels. It is a white powder that is used as a thickening agent in cooking. When heated, corn starch absorbs water and swells, creating a thick gel. This gel can be used to thicken sauces, gravies, and soups.

Corn Starch and Potatoes

When corn starch is applied to potatoes, it forms a coating on the surface. This coating helps to prevent moisture from escaping from the potatoes, resulting in a crispy exterior. The corn starch also helps to create a Maillard reaction, which is the browning of food that occurs when it is heated. This reaction contributes to the golden color and delicious flavor of crispy roast potatoes.

How to Use Corn Starch to Make Crispy Potatoes

To make crispy roast potatoes using corn starch, follow these steps:

1. Peel and cut the potatoes: Peel the potatoes and cut them into evenly sized pieces.
2. Toss the potatoes with corn starch: In a large bowl, toss the potatoes with corn starch. Make sure that the potatoes are evenly coated.
3. Season the potatoes: Season the potatoes with salt, pepper, and any other desired herbs or spices.
4. Roast the potatoes: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C). Spread the potatoes on a baking sheet and roast them for 20-25 minutes, or until they are golden brown and crispy.
5. Serve the potatoes: Serve the crispy roast potatoes immediately with your favorite dipping sauce or condiment.

Tips for Making the Crispiest Potatoes

  • Use russet potatoes: Russet potatoes are the best type of potatoes for roasting because they have a high starch content.
  • Cut the potatoes evenly: Cutting the potatoes evenly will ensure that they cook evenly.
  • Don’t overcrowd the baking sheet: Overcrowding the baking sheet will prevent the potatoes from getting crispy.
  • Flip the potatoes halfway through roasting: Flipping the potatoes halfway through roasting will help them to cook evenly and prevent them from burning.
  • Don’t overcook the potatoes: Overcooked potatoes will be soft and mushy.

Other Ways to Make Crispy Potatoes

While corn starch is a great way to make crispy potatoes, there are other methods you can try:

  • Parboiling: Parboiling is a method of boiling potatoes before roasting them. This helps to remove excess starch and create a crispier exterior.
  • Baking powder: Baking powder can be added to potatoes before roasting to help them crisp up.
  • Olive oil: Olive oil can be used to coat potatoes before roasting to help them crisp up.
